         <title>STATISTICAL METHODS COVERED IN THIS COURSE</title>
         <author>braunitzergabor</author>
         <link>https://padlet.com/braunitzergabor/biometry/wish/120147526</link>
         <description><![CDATA[<div>1. DESCRIPTIVE STATISTICS (mean, mode, median, dispersion)<br>2. COMPARING THE MEANS OF TWO OR MORE DATASETS (ANOVA, Mann-Whitney U, Kruskal-Wallis)<br>3. ASSOCIATION BETWEEN TWO CONTINUOUS VARIABLES (correlation, regression)<br>4. ASSOCIATION BETWEEN TWO CATEGORICAL VARIABLES (chi-square)<br><br>By the end of the course the student will be able to use STATISTICA for Windows for the following:&nbsp;<br>- to give a basic description of a given dataset<br>- to compare two or more datasets and tell if they are statistically different<br>-to tell if two continuous variables are associated, and if they are, which one has an effect on the other<br>-to tell if two categorical variables are associated<br><br>Furthermore, the student will be able to apply these skills to analyze simple experimental datasets. </div>]]></description>

         <title>BASIC CONCEPTS</title>
         <author>braunitzergabor</author>
         <link>https://padlet.com/braunitzergabor/biometry/wish/120147645</link>
         <description><![CDATA[<div>1. the difference&nbsp; between mean, mode and median<br>2. the importance of standard deviation<br>3. the concept of normal distribution<br>4. continuous/categorical variables<br>5. statistical significance (p value)<br>6. dependent and independent samples<br><strong>THE STEPS OF A BASIC STATISTICAL ANALYSIS:</strong><br>a. determine the type of the variables<br>b. check for the normality of distribution (Shapiro-Wilk p&gt; 0.0)<br>c. determine if the datasets are independent<br>d. based on a-c, choose and perform the appropriate test<br>e. interpret the results</div>]]></description>
